Entry Cost
Unaffiliated: £36.00
Affiliated: £34.00

Race Description:
The Fleam Dyke Trail Marathon is a scenic, single-loop trail marathon. The race route takes in most of the historical Anglo-Saxon Fleam Dyke and the Roman Road long distance path on the south-east side of Cambridge. There is also a half marathon race.
The races starts at Balsham Village Hall near Cambridge, both loops head out north-west along Fleam Dyke until reaching Fulbourn Fen where the route heads south before picking up the Roman Road heading south-east away from Cambridge. Just south of Balsham the half marathon loop branches off to return to the hall while the marathon route continues with a few short road sections to villages Withersfield, Weston Green and Weston Colville before returning back to Balsham. The half marathon loop is nearly entirely trail, and the marathon route around 85% trail.
Included are refreshments at checkpoints, finishers medal, donation on your behalf to our partner, Friends of the Roman Road and Fleam Dyke which helps towards conservation and route maintenance.
